One secret tore my life apart. It sent me running from the place I thought I would be safe, right into the path of untold enemies.

But when my life is in danger, the wolves I thought I’d lost for good are the ones who come for me. And they’ll burn down the world to keep me safe—even if none of us trusts each other anymore.

With every moment we’re forced together, every whispered apology and stolen touch, my resolve to keep them at a distance weakens. And when I realize just how much each of these men has come to mean to me, that resolve crumbles to dust.

Only there are more secrets to uncover—all our pasts lurking in the shadows. And when the monsters emerge from the darkness, there’s no escaping them this time…

**Book Two in the Wolves of Crescent Creek Series. If you haven't met the wolves yet, their story begins in Crescent Kingdom.**

Another stunner! Eclipsed Empire by Tessa Hale was a seductive and suspenseful wolf shifter romance that ravaged my heart from start to finish. Wren’s haunting and complex past continued to keep me on the edge of my seat, also making me swoon with her connecting deeper and more intimately with her wolf fellas. This is book two in the Wolves of Crescent Creek, so prep your heart for another cliffy ending.

Vanessa Moyen performs this audiobook in dual narration featuring Connor Crais, Shane East, Jason Clarke, J.F. Harding, and Teddy Hamilton. This cast continues to leave me in awe! Vanessa’s expressive voice captured Wren’s fierce, strong, and passionate persona as she grew closer to her mates and faced her haunting past. Shane developed a devoted charismatic tone for Puck while JF gave Locke a quiet confidence that was admirable. Teddy’s loveable tone shed Brix’ guarded exterior, and Connor once again created a powerful dominance as the pack leader for Kingston. Jason’s signature growl portrayed Ender’s fighter persona. The cast turned up the heat with the fated chemistry between Wren and her mates.

Overall, I LOVED this book. Exactly what I'm looking for in a Tessa Hale book. This one picks up from the cliffhanger ending of Book 1. Its weird to say that I enjoyed Wren's torture, but these scenes are well written and realistic enough. There is no minimizing what happens and I appreciate that. I enjoyed the unique reconnection of each of the interpersonal relationships - during the aftermath of the trauma and memory sharing. The groveling. The mates processing Wren's secret, etc. Reverse harem/multiple fated mate books tend to have archetypes, but this one has Locke, who I think is a very distinct male character, and I fell in love with him even more. JF Harding nails this performance. Vanessa Moyen carries the book with her sound delivery. All of these narrators (Connor Crais, Jason Clarke, Shane East, Teddy Hamilton) are fantastic and bring such heart and personalization to each of the characters. We finally get to meet Bastian Boudreaux. The ending is brutal and, you guessed it, a cliffhanger.
